Output de780c717aed00026df944b048494e79342260b17bcc92b542541d62a6d57ba0:0

value
5817084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c65e5177d2b24272ea60133a9a297a159b8de1 OP_EQUAL
address
3MTDWrnyvTJBJkHgW7H2QoahzW66rwPojP
transaction
de780c717aed00026df944b048494e79342260b17bcc92b542541d62a6d57ba0
confirmations
239540
spent
true